Moana 2 Box Office Sets Multiple Records On Opening Day
Nov 28, 2024
Moana 2 sets a new preview record for Disney animation ahead of its official release. The family film is a sequel to the original Moana, which became a cultural sensation after its arrival on the streaming platform. Moana 2’s story is set three years after the events in the original and sees Moana (voiced by Auli’i Cravalho) and Maui (Dwayne Johnson) reunite for their most dangerous voyage to date. The film previews on Tuesday, November 26, but doesn’t officially arrive until Wednesday, November 27.
Moana 2 opened with a record-shattering $13.8 million preview sales at the box office, according to The Hollywood Reporter. This marks the biggest preview ever for a Walt Disney animation title and launches the film as the second-biggest preview for any animated film, right behind Pixar’s Incredibles 2’s $18.5 million preview opening. Moana 2 breaks another record as the top Tuesday, pre-Thanksgiving preview gross of all time. The sequel is projected to gross from $125 million to $135 million over the five-day debut period as the biggest Thanksgiving opening of all time.
What This Means For Moana 2
Moana 2 Could Easily Top Wicked And Gladiator II At The Box Office
Preview screenings for Moana 2 began at 2 pm on Tuesday with only 48%of schools and 20% of colleges closed. Being a family film, the sequel is good for all ages, where Wicked is targeted for age 8 and up, and Scott Ridley’s highly-anticipated Gladiator II is designed for an adult audience. Entering into the Thanksgiving weekend, Moana 2’s box office will likely see an even bigger swing upward.

Universal’s big-budget musical, Wicked, has generated $144.0 million at the domestic box office and $195 million worldwide. Meanwhile, Gladiator II amassed over $220 million worldwide. It’s likely that Moana 2 will surpass both films at the box office as its opening weekend coincides with Thanksgiving. The original animated film didn’t make a splash at the box office, but it found success on the streaming platforms. With the sequel’s soundtrack being a highlight, it also seems likely that Moana 2’s success won’t stop at the box office.
Our Take On Moana 2
Moana 2 Sees Growth In Moana & Maui
Taking place three years after Maui helped Moana restore the heart of the Te Fiti, the sequel reunites the two on a dangerous adventure to break a curse. Though Moana 2’s critical score on Rotten Tomatoes is lower than the original, the film has a glowing audience approval rate of 89%, which is the same as the original.
Screen Rant’s own review of Moana 2 notes the powerful themes it tackles as the titular heroine is “looking beyond herself and to the future and what it means for her people.” From the soundtracks to character developments and relationships, the sequel easily sets itself apart from the original. Moana was fearless due to her last experience in the first film, but having grown attached to her little sister as she grew as a wayseeker, Moana 2 sees her dealing with more complicated emotions.
